===Act One===
===Act One===


Lorroakan is first mentioned by [[Aradin]] in [[Act 1]], whom the party meets outside of the [[Druid Grove]]. Aradin will tell the party about a huge sum of money offered by a wizard, in exchange for a treasure called the Nightsong.

He is also mentioned by [[Rolan]], who is especially proud of the fact that Lorroakan has accepted him as his student, with that being his primary reason for travelling to Baldur's Gate. Gale, however, notes that he's a bit of a cad.

===Act Three ===

Arriving in the city of Baldur's Gate in Act 3, the party is tasked to meet with Lorroakan to find out what he wants with the [[Dame Aylin|Nightsong]].

Manning the till at [[Sorcerous Sundries]], the party will find Rolan with a bloodied face. A successful Insight check will reveal that, despite his cheerful tone, there's something wrong. If asked about the Nightsong, Rolan will divulge that many people have come to claim Lorroakan's bounty to no avail. He will also warn them about Lorroakan's temper if they plan on bringing him information about the Nightsong.

Lorroakan has been in contact with [[Ketheric Thorm|Ketheric]] and [[Balthazar]] and has searched for Dame Aylin to give himself the same ability of Ketheric's: immortality.<ref name="kethericletter">''[[Ornate Letter]]''</ref>

The party can answer truthfully as to the whereabouts of Nightsong, or succeed various [[Ability Check]]s to deceive him into believing that she has been killed.<!-- What are the choices if Nightsong died in Act 2? -->

If Aylin is at camp and later informed of Lorrokan's intentions, she will depart for Ramazith's Tower to confront him, despite [[Isobel|Isobel's]] efforts to stop her.

==== Helping the Nightsong ====

If the party side with Aylin, Lorroakan will be joined in battle by one of each elemental type of [[myrmidon]], Miklaur and [[Krank]], all being able to [[fly]] at will. His [[Earth Myrmidon]] can cast [[Stoneskin]] on him, and each myrmidon will unlock one spell slot for him while alive.

Lorroakan's death brings an end to the hunt for Aylin. If the party saved his family during Act 2, Rolan will take over as proprietor of Sorcerous Sundries. Rolan also promises aid for [[Gather Your Allies]], granting {{SAI|Rolan's Firestorm}} during the final battle. If the party haven't, he will die in combat, siding Lorroakan.

Siding with Lorroakan will cause Aylin to become hostile, summoning four [[Moonlight Sliver]]s to her aid.  
Siding with Lorroakan will cause Aylin to become hostile, summoning four [[Moonlight Sliver]]s to her aid.  


When she is defeated, Lorroakan will subsequently jail Aylin in another [[Find the Nightsong|soul cage]], allowing him his sought-for immortality. Lorroakan will reward the party with 5000 gold, and lend his aid for [[Gather Your Allies]], granting {{SAI|Lorroakan's Firestorm}} during the final battle (an identical [[Class action|Class Action]] to Rolan's).

Returning to Isobel, informing her of Aylin's recapture, but deceiving her as to the party's betrayal will cause her to rush to Ramazith's Tower to confront Lorroakan herself.

However, only her corpse will be found when the party travels there, having been killed by Lorroakan off-screen. Aylin, having witnessed the death of her lover occur steps from where she stands imprisoned, will be horrified, and vows to murder the player character, and their descendants, upon her escape. Lorroakan himself makes no mention of the fight.
